Hello, this is the Audubon Society of Portland Rare Bird Report. This report
was made Thursday October 9. If you have anything to add call Harry Nehls at
503-233-3976.

On October 6 a RED-THROATED PIPIT was seen and videotaped on the dry lakebed
of Wickiup Reservoir south of Bend. Five CHESTNUT-COLLARED LONGSPURS and one
LAPLAND LONGSPUR are also there. They are still being seen. A
CHESTNUT-COLLARED LONGSPUR was at the Necanicum River mouth at Gearhart
October 5.

Two possible BAY-BREASTED WARBLERS were reported October 4 at the Ogden
Wayside north of Redmond. A SCISSOR-TAILED FLYCATCHER is being seen near
Burns. A TENNESSEE WARBLER was at the Redmond Sewage Ponds October 2.

A dark phased SWAINSON?S HAWK was at Lone Ranch State Park north of
Brookings October 4. That day a LAPLAND LONGSPUR was on Whisky Run Beach
north of Bandon. Two PALM WARBLERS were at North Bend October 7. One was at
Yaquina Bay October 5. Two ANCIENT MURRELETS were off the jetties there
October 4. Many landbirds landed on offshore fishing boats during the week
including a NORTHERN WATERTHRUSH off Garibaldi October 3. On October 5 a
TROPICAL KINGBIRD was along Highway 101 at Camp Rilea. On October 2 two
PACIFIC GOLDEN-PLOVERS and a BLACK-LEGGED KITTIWAKE were at the South Jetty
of the Columbia River. Ten SNOWY PLOVERS were reported from there October 6..

On October 2 a SURF SCOTER was on the Columbia River off Camas. On October 7
a MARBLED GODWIT and an EURASIAN WIGEON were found at Oaks Bottoms in
Portland. A SURF SCOTER and two HORNED GREBES were at the Fernhill wetlands
October 4. That day an AVOCET was found at Finley NWR. On October 8 a
WHITE-THROATED SPARROW was near Grants Pass.

On October 8 two RED-BREASTED MERGANSERS and a CATBIRD were at Tumalo
Reservoir west of Bend. A SWAMP SPARROW was at nearby Tumalo State Park the
next day. On October 4 a NORTHERN WATERTHRUSH was at Cow Lakes near Jordan
Valley. Several WHITE-THROATED SPARROWS were seen during the week at Malheur
NWR.
